well for starters the overall speed of donut is just awesome, there other thing is that there is no fillrate on donut so 3dapps,games and 2d games also don't have that slowness and stutter you get in eclair/froyo(they both lack fillrate or should i say a fixed fillrate?) phh would know how to explain fillrate better than me, but anyways basically it stops the screen from filling extra pixels, Do too our screen being vga. This slows down 3dapps considerably, if you want to see this just run lets say Raging Thuder 2 you will notice how fast it is in donut, and how it stutters and seems like a jpg slideshow on elcair/froyo

Hi, I'll give you a simple HOWTO :
1. Download this.
2. Extract the contents of the archive to the root of your FRESH FAT32
formatted microSD, excepting the system.ext2
(if it's SDHC(larger than 2-4GB), microSD shouldn't be class 6 and higher)
3. Download this.
4. Extract the system.ext2 to the root of the microSD
5. Run HaRET.exe and have fun!!
Edit: if the andro does not boot successfully, try to use the latest modules and rootfs
